Acquisition had left Orbital with fourteen storefronts on five different platforms. A pricing change took six weeks to roll out globally. The median page weighed 4.8MB and the slowest market had a 6.2-second largest contentful paint on 4G.
Catalogue, pricing and checkout consolidated into a single service; storefronts became configuration and theme rather than separate codebases.
A 180KB JavaScript budget per route, enforced in CI. Three planned features were cut for failing it, which is the point of having a budget.
Smallest market first as the pathfinder, largest sixth of nine once the pattern was proven, with the legacy stack kept warm for rollback throughout.
